Career
He was signed as an undrafted free agent by the Alouettes in 2008. He played college football for the Baylor Bears, where he majored in communications. In 2011, he took over the starting role from Avon Cobourne and it had huge returns as he led the Canadian Football League in rushing with 1,381 yards.
He also added 638 receiving yards to surpass 2,000 yards from scrimmage and had six 100 yard rushing games.
He is the son of Aaron Whitaker and Denise Hill.
